JALAPENO POTATO SALAD



Jalapeno Potato Salad image

Field editor Sarah Woodruff of Watertown, South Dakota puts a zippy spin on potato salad. It's perfect for a picnic!

Time 30m

Yield 5 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 10

6 medium red potatoes, peeled and cubed
2 celery ribs, chopped
2 hard-boiled large eggs, chopped
1/4 cup chopped onion
2 small jalapeno peppers, seeded and chopped
1/4 cup mayonnaise
3 tablespoons spicy brown mustard
3 teaspoons hot pepper sauce
1/4 teaspoon ground cumin
1/4 teaspoon pepper

Steps:

  • Place the potatoes in a large saucepan and cover with water. Bring to a boil. Reduce heat; cover and cook for 10-15 minutes or until tender. Drain; cool to room temperature. , In a large serving bowl, combine the potatoes, celery, eggs, onion and jalapenos. , In a small bowl, combine the mayonnaise, mustard, hot pepper sauce, cumin and pepper. Pour over potato mixture and toss gently to coat. Cover and refrigerate overnight.

JALAPEñO POTATO SALAD



Jalapeño Potato Salad image

From a cook book called: Barbecue Crossroads by Walsh. This is a favorite Texas potato salad for those who like it spicy!

Time 25m

Number Of Ingredients 11

4 large potatoes, peeled and cut into cubes
1/4 c dijon mustard
1/4 c white wine vinegar
2 clove garlic, crushed
1/4 tsp salt
1/4 tsp black pepper
1/2 c olive oil
3to4 oz black olives, drained
1/4 c scallions, sliced
6 oz feta cheese, crumbled
4 jalapeños, seeded and chopped

Steps:

  • 1. Place potatoes in large saucepan and pour in cold water to cover. Bring to boil. Reduce heat, simmer for 10 minutes or until potatoes are tender. Drain.
  • 2. Meanwhile, combine mustard, vinegar, garlic, salt and pepper in large bowl. Slowly whisk in oil. Add potatoes, olives, scallions, cheese and peppers. Toss to mix well. Serve chilled or at room temperature.

Tips:

  • Choose the right potatoes for your salad. Waxy potatoes, such as red potatoes or fingerling potatoes, hold their shape better when cooked and are less likely to fall apart in the salad.
  • Boil your potatoes until they are just tender. If you overcook them, they will become mushy and won't hold their shape in the salad.
  • Add your favorite ingredients to the salad. Some popular additions include celery, onion, hard-boiled eggs, bacon, and cheese.
  • Use a light dressing. A heavy dressing will weigh down the salad and make it less refreshing.
  • Chill the salad before serving. This will help the flavors to meld and the salad will be more refreshing.
